Patents Assigned to FutureWei Technologies
-
Patent number: 9647876Abstract: A method for providing a link identifier (LID), wherein the method comprises obtaining a first identifier block (IDB) that identifies an external interface within a first domain using a first identifying scheme, obtaining a second IDB that identifies a second external interface within a second domain using a second identifying scheme, creating the LID that comprises the first IDB and the second IDB, and advertising the LID to one or more external entities.Type: GrantFiled: October 21, 2013Date of Patent: May 9, 2017Assignee: Futurewei Technologies, Inc.Inventors: T. Benjamin Mack-Crane, Susan Kay Hares, Charles E. Perkins
-
Patent number: 9648599Abstract: A method for signaling control information in a communications system includes identifying a first subframe to carry first control information, and determining whether the first subframe is configured as a device-to-device (D2D) subframe. The method also includes transmitting the first control information in the first subframe to an evolved NodeB (eNB) when the first subframe is not configured as a D2D subframe, wherein the first control information is encoded with a first encoding rule in accordance with a first subframe, and transmitting the first control information in a second subframe when the first subframe is configured as a D2D subframe, wherein the first control information is encoded with a second encoding rule in accordance with the second subframe.Type: GrantFiled: March 19, 2015Date of Patent: May 9, 2017Assignee: FUTUREWEI TECHNOLOGIES, INC.Inventors: Philippe Sartori, Vipul Desai, Mazin Al-Shalash, Anthony C. K. Soong
-
Patent number: 9648027Abstract: A method including generating a segment signature for a segment of a media content based on the segment, trusted information contained in a media presentation description (MPD), and a signature signing key, wherein the MPD describes the media content, wherein the segment signature is independent of other segment signatures corresponding to other segments of the media content, and wherein a single copy of the segment signature is configured to be transmitted to a client requesting the segment of the media content thereby permitting the client to determine authenticity of the segment without receiving any additional segment signatures.Type: GrantFiled: March 10, 2016Date of Patent: May 9, 2017Assignee: Futurewei Technologies, Inc.Inventors: Xin Wang, Yongliang Liu
-
Patent number: 9645956Abstract: An apparatus for initialization. The apparatus includes a management I/O device controller for managing initialization of a plurality of I/O devices coupled to a PCI-Express (PCIe) fabric. The management I/O device controller is configured for receiving a request to register a target interrupt register address of a first worker computing resource, wherein the target interrupt register address is associated with a first interrupt generated by a first I/O device coupled to the PCIe fabric. A mapping module of the management I/O device controller is configured for mapping the target interrupt register address to a mapped interrupt register address of a domain in which the first I/O device resides. A translating interrupt register table includes a plurality of mapped interrupt register addresses in the domain that is associated with a plurality of target interrupt register addresses of a plurality of worker computing resources.Type: GrantFiled: October 7, 2016Date of Patent: May 9, 2017Assignee: Futurewei Technologies, Inc.Inventors: Norbert Egi, Robert Lasater, Thomas Boyle, John Peters, Guangyu Shi
-
Patent number: 9645844Abstract: System and method embodiments are provided for multi-version support in indexes in a database. The embodiments enable substantially optimized multi-version support in index and avoid backfill of commit log sequence number (LSN) for a transaction identifier (TxID). In an embodiment, a method in a data processing system for managing a database includes determining with the data processing system whether a record is deleted according to a delete indicator in an index leaf page record corresponding to the record; and determining with the data processing system, when the record is not deleted, whether the record is visible according to a new record indicator in the index leaf page record and according to a comparison of a system commit TxID at the transaction start with a record commit TxID obtained from the index leaf page record.Type: GrantFiled: March 28, 2014Date of Patent: May 9, 2017Assignee: Futurewei Technologies, Inc.Inventor: Guogen Zhang
-
Patent number: 9647962Abstract: In a high-dimensional PCI-Express (PCIe) network, implementation of alternative paths is accomplished to facilitate flexible topology implementation and network domain scaling while enabling improved communication latency. Different portions of the PCIe tree structure are connected to allow a shorter path for communications by utilizing a bridge circuit configured as an end-point with respect to two switches that are not directly connected in the PCIe tree topology. The bridge circuit performs address translations to allow communications from one switch to be passed via the bridge circuit to the other switch.Type: GrantFiled: August 15, 2016Date of Patent: May 9, 2017Assignee: Futurewei Technologies, Inc.Inventors: Norbert Egi, Robert Lasater, Guangyu Shi, Thomas Boyle
-
Patent number: 9648484Abstract: A method for performing open discovery in a communications system includes determining, by a device-to-device (D2D ) device, resource allocation information for a discovery cycle including discovery resources allocated for transmission of discovery signals by D2D devices. The method also includes selecting, by the D2D device, a first discovery resource of the discovery cycle in accordance with the resource allocation information, and transmitting, by the D2D device, a discovery signal in the selected first discovery resource.Type: GrantFiled: August 7, 2014Date of Patent: May 9, 2017Assignee: FUTUREWEI TECHNOLOGIES, INC.Inventors: Philippe Sartori, Hossein Bagheri, Anthony C. K. Soong
-
Patent number: 9647622Abstract: An embodiment method includes measuring, by a calibration device, a first output voltage of a variable gain amplifier (VGA) when the VGA is set at a first gain setting and measuring, by a calibration device, a second output voltage of the VGA when the VGA is set at a second gain setting different from the first gain setting. The method further includes calculating, by the calibration device, an offset voltage of a signal path including the VGA using the first output voltage and the second output voltage and calculating, by the calibration device, an internal offset voltage of the VGA using the first output voltage and the second output voltage.Type: GrantFiled: October 22, 2015Date of Patent: May 9, 2017Assignee: FUTUREWEI TECHNOLOGIES, INC.Inventors: Kent Jaeger, Zhihang Zhang, Matthew Miller, Ramesh Chadalawada
-
Patent number: 9646091Abstract: A device comprises a receiver configured to receive a join-lookup remote procedural call (RPC) for a file, wherein the join-lookup RPC requests a join operation of sub-files associated with the file, and a transmitter configured to transmit the file in response to the Join-Lookup RPC. A distributed file system (DFS) client comprises a transmitter configured to transmit a join-lookup RPC for a file, wherein the join-lookup RPC requests a join operation of sub-files associated with the file, and a receiver configured to receive the file in response to the Join-Lookup RPC. A method comprises receiving a join-lookup RPC for a file, wherein the join-lookup RPC requests a join operation of sub-files associated with the file, and transmitting the file in response to the Join-Lookup RPC.Type: GrantFiled: February 24, 2014Date of Patent: May 9, 2017Assignee: Futurewei Technologies, Inc.Inventors: Vineet Chadha, Guangyu Shi
-
Patent number: 9646162Abstract: A method comprising encrypting a segment in response to receiving a segment request to generate an encrypted segment, and sending the encrypted segment, wherein encrypting the segment comprises encrypting a data content segment and a non-media segment in accordance with information provided in a dynamic adaptive streaming over hypertext transfer protocol (HTTP) (DASH) media presentation description (MPD), and wherein encrypting the segment generates an encrypted data content segment and an encrypted non-media segment. A method comprising sending a segment request, receiving an encrypted segment, wherein the encrypted segment comprises an encrypted data content segment and an encrypted non-media segment, and decrypting the encrypted segment in accordance with information provided in a DASH MPD to generate a data content segment and a non-media segment, wherein the non-media segment comprises a non-playable media.Type: GrantFiled: April 8, 2014Date of Patent: May 9, 2017Assignee: Futurewei Technologies, Inc.Inventor: Alexander Giladi
-
Patent number: 9647767Abstract: A signal processing method including obtaining, using an optical receiver, a data signal that comprises one or more pairs of pilot tones and a plurality of subcarrier signals, identifying the one or more pairs of pilot tones, determining a local oscillator frequency offset estimation for the data signal using the one or more pairs of pilot tones, wherein the local oscillator frequency offset estimation indicates a frequency offset, and compensating the data signal in accordance with the local oscillator frequency offset estimation. A signal processing method including obtaining, using an optical receiver, a data signal that comprises one or more pairs of pilot tones and a plurality of subcarrier signals, identifying the one or more pairs of pilot tones, determining a chromatic dispersion estimation for the data signal using the one or more pairs of pilot tones, and compensating the data signal in accordance with the chromatic dispersion estimation.Type: GrantFiled: August 20, 2015Date of Patent: May 9, 2017Assignee: Futurewei Technologies, Inc.Inventors: Qing Guo, Fei Zhu, Yu Sheng Bai
-
Patent number: 9648147Abstract: The present invention provides a system and method for TCP High Availability. The system concurrently delivers incoming data streams to AMB and SMB, concurrently sends outgoing data streams originated from AMB to SMB and peer routers, synchronizes the incoming and outgoing data streams between AMB and SMB, and accelerates the synchronizations of the incoming and outgoing data streams between AMB and SMB.Type: GrantFiled: December 21, 2007Date of Patent: May 9, 2017Assignee: Futurewei Technologies, Inc.Inventors: Huaimo Chen, Steve Yao
-
Publication number: 20170127087Abstract: A method, an apparatus and a decoder for decoding a block of a depth map are provided. An ordered list of decoding modes is obtained, wherein the ordered list of decoding modes comprises a plurality of decoding modes each of which is capable of being used for decoding of the block. A plurality of depth modeling modes (DMMs) each of which is capable of being used for decoding of the block are obtained. And whether a DMM of the plurality of DMMs is to be added into the ordered list of decoding modes in accordance with a decision condition is determined.Type: ApplicationFiled: November 21, 2016Publication date: May 4, 2017Applicants: Futurewei Technologies, Inc., Santa Clara UniversityInventors: Zhouye GU, Jianhua ZHENG, Nam LING, Chen-Xiong ZHANG
-
Patent number: 9641276Abstract: An optical line terminal (OLT) in a time and wavelength division multiplexed (TWDM) passive optical network (PON). The OLT comprises a first optical port, a second optical port, and a processor. The first optical port is configured to couple to a plurality of optical network units (ONUs) via an optical distribution network (ODN). The second optical port is configured to couple to the ONUs via the ODN. The processor is coupled to the first optical port and the second optical port and is configured such that, responsive to receiving information indicating that the first optical port has experienced a greater power loss over time than the second optical port, the OLT assigns to the first optical port a first wavelength with a power greater than the power of a second wavelength assigned to the second optical port.Type: GrantFiled: May 15, 2014Date of Patent: May 2, 2017Assignee: Futurewei Technologies, Inc.Inventors: Frank J. Effenberger, Lei Zong, Dekun Liu
-
Patent number: 9642099Abstract: A transmit power control rule for device-to-device (D2D) transmissions may not be necessary during periods in which no uplink transmissions are scheduled to be received by an enhanced Node B base station (eNB). When uplink transmissions are not scheduled to be received by the eNB, the eNB may send a transmit power control (TPC) command to a D2D capable user equipment (D2D UE) that instructs the D2D UE to perform a D2D transmission at a pre-defined transmit power level (e.g., maximum transmit power level). When uplink transmissions are scheduled to be received the eNB, the eNB may send a TPC command to the D2D UE that instructs the D2D UE to perform a D2D transmission at a transmit power level defined by a power control rule.Type: GrantFiled: May 5, 2015Date of Patent: May 2, 2017Assignee: Futurewei Technologies, Inc.Inventors: Hossein Bagheri, Philippe Sartori, Mazin Al-Shalash, Anthony C. K. Soong
-
Patent number: 9641286Abstract: A transmitter including a noise signal generator and a summing element is provided. The noise signal generator is configured to receive multiple noise settings and output multiple noise signals corresponding to the multiple noise settings. The summing element is configured to receive a transmit data signal and the multiple noise signals, sum one or more of the multiple noise signals with the transmit data signal, and output to a transmit driver configured to generate one of a single-ended and a differential signal based on the sum of the one or more of the multiple noise signals with the transmit data signal.Type: GrantFiled: May 27, 2015Date of Patent: May 2, 2017Assignee: Futurewei Technologies, Inc.Inventors: Hiroshi Takatori, Kofi Anim-Appiah, Hang Yan
-
Patent number: 9638857Abstract: An apparatus comprising a waveguide along a longitudinal axis at a first elevation, an optical splitter coupled to a first edge of the waveguide along the longitudinal axis, two or more inverse tapers coupled to a second edge of the optical splitter along the longitudinal axis, and one or more offset inverse tapers that are substantially parallel with the two or more inverse tapers, wherein the one or more offset inverse tapers are along the longitudinal axis at a second elevation.Type: GrantFiled: October 28, 2014Date of Patent: May 2, 2017Assignee: Futurewei Technologies, Inc.Inventors: Yu Sheng Bai, Huapu Pan
-
Patent number: 9641373Abstract: An apparatus comprises: a receiver port configured to receive an input signal comprising in-phase and quadrature (IQ) data and control words (CWs); a peak-to-average power (PAPR) reducer coupled to the receiver port and configured to: receive the IQ data, process the IQ data, separate the IQ data into a clipped signal and a peak signal, and determine peak information associated with the peak signal; and a transmitter port coupled to the PAPR reducer and configured to separately transmit the clipped signal and the peak information. A method comprises: receiving an input signal comprising first data and second data; processing the first data; separating the first data into a clipped signal and a peak signal; determining peak information associated with the peak signal; and transmitting the clipped signal and the peak information.Type: GrantFiled: June 14, 2016Date of Patent: May 2, 2017Assignee: Futurewei Technologies, Inc.Inventors: Huaiyu Zeng, Xiang Liu, Frank Effenberger, Guozhu Long
-
Patent number: 9642101Abstract: A system and method for uplink multi-antenna power control in a communications system are provided. A method for user equipment operations includes determining a transmit power level for transmit antennas of the user equipment having at least two transmit antennas, and setting a power amplifier output level for each of the at least two transmit antennas in accordance with a respective transmit power level.Type: GrantFiled: August 11, 2015Date of Patent: May 2, 2017Assignee: Futurewei Technologies, Inc.Inventor: Weimin Xiao
-
Patent number: 9641729Abstract: Embodiments are provided herein to achieve video or image sequence encoding with an improved denoising algorithm that is both efficient computationally and has acceptable overhead cost in comparison to other denoising schemes for video encoding. The embodiments include using recursive bilateral filtering as part of the denoising algorithm, which is integrated into a video encoder to overcome limitations of other encoder-integrated denoising algorithms. An embodiment method includes receiving, at a filtering and residual computation function at the encoder, a macro block comprising a plurality of pixels. The filtering and residual computation function also receives, from a motion estimation function at the encoder, a reference block. The reference block comprises a plurality of reference pixels corresponding to the macro block.Type: GrantFiled: April 26, 2013Date of Patent: May 2, 2017Assignee: Futurewei Technologies, Inc.Inventors: Dong-Qing Zhang, Bo Wang, Hong Heather Yu, Jianyu Zhang